AECOM is hiring an Associate:Cost Management

Responsibilities

  • Lead the delivery of Cost Management commissions, ensuring they are completed on time, within scope, and to a high standard of client satisfaction.
  • Provide leadership, guidance, and mentorship to Senior Surveyors, Project Surveyors, and Graduates, supporting their development and performance.
  • Act as the primary point of contact for AECOM clients (both new and existing) across assigned projects, building and maintaining strong, trusted relationships.
  • Oversee the efficient management of commissions, ensuring effective coordination of resources and delivery teams.
  • Identify, develop, and lead bids for Cost Management services across the region, supporting business growth and opportunity generation.
  • Ensure all team members under your supervision maintain appropriate and up-to-date training and professional development.
  • Manage the delivery of Cost Management outputs in line with agreed timelines, quality expectations, and client requirements.

Requirements

  • Degree Qualified – BSc or MSc – in Quantity Surveying / Cost Management.
  • Professionally Qualified – Chartered Quantity Surveying Status with the SCSI / RICS
  • 8-10 years proven experience in a consulting environment providing the full spectrum of CM services including Pre Contract Estimating; Procurement; Contract Administration, Cost Reporting and Final Account resolution.
  • Understanding of Public Works Contracts and RIAI standard forms of contract
  • Proven ability to advise clients and design teams on cost, value and risk, not just cost in isolation.
  • Excellent IT Skills and the ability to utilize digital measurement, cost planning and tender document tools shall be essential.
